PayPal cheats its customers and keeps their money.
For some reason, even though a person can use his credit card and PayPal can receive an Approval Authorization Code from the credit card company that the charge is approved, PayPal developed a new system that gives them the right to debit/charge your credit card account in order to confirm or verify it. It is a tactic to get your money and hold onto it.
They charged my American Express card $1.95 and then put a secret code that shows up on my American Express Statement when the charge goes through. I am required to enter that code at the PayPal website… and then, they do not credit the $1.95 back to my American Express card… they credit it to me in a PayPal online credit balance… requiring me to use PayPal to pay for something in order to recoup my $1.95.
They won’t credit back my American Express card. I have to spend more money through PayPal to ever get my $1.95 back.
I went around PayPal and called American Express. Amex is going to credit my account, and PayPal can sit there with a credit in my account till hell freezes over.
